Commitment to Quality and Precision

Consultio’s journey began with a singular focus: delivering gears that exceed the most stringent quality standards. Recognizing that precision is non-negotiable in sectors like aerospace, automotive, and medical devices, the company implemented rigorous quality control protocols. Every gear undergoes meticulous inspection using advanced metrology tools, such as coordinate measuring machines (CMMs) and 3D scanning, ensuring tolerances within ±0.005 mm.

This commitment has translated into tangible results. Consultio boasts a defect rate of less than 0.05%, a benchmark far surpassing the industry average of 0.2%. Such precision has earned the company certifications like ISO 9001:2015 and AS9100D, underscoring its alignment with global aerospace standards. Over the past decade, Consultio has supplied 1.2 million precision gears to more than 500 clients across 30 countries, a testament to its reliability.


Investment in Advanced Technology

Staying ahead in precision engineering requires constant innovation. Consultio allocates 15% of its annual revenue to research and development, fueling breakthroughs in gear design and manufacturing. The company employs state-of-the-art technologies such as 5-axis CNC machining, robotic automation, and AI-driven predictive maintenance systems. These tools enable production cycles up to 40% faster than traditional methods while maintaining unmatched accuracy.

A recent upgrade to IoT-enabled manufacturing floors has reduced downtime by 25%, thanks to real-time monitoring of equipment health. Clients also benefit from Consultio’s proprietary software, GearGenius™, which simulates gear performance under extreme conditions, ensuring optimal design before production begins.
